One may ask why I post this picture for the New Year, instead of the usual red, red pics. Hmm...
Most people , at the new year , will make some new year wishes or resolution to work towards, or at least convinced by the media that they should.
However, this year, I beg to differ: For this coming year, I wish that ... I won't have to wish much?!?! In other words - I wish for contentment for peace of mind, hence tranquility; and hence, the reason for this picture - a symbolism for tranquility.
Coincidentally, bamboo (竹)in Chinese sounds like (足), not as in leg, but as in enough, contented, as in 知足长乐.

After pondering through what makes a mind disturbed or troubled ...
I have come to a understanding/realization that a pre-requisite for a peace of mind, or at least one of the pre-requisites, is doing the right thing. There is a saying:
Moral Courage is doing the right thing.
But I think doing the right thing is important not only for moral courage, but also for future peace of mind.
Basic cause and effect will us that if I were to be lazy and not do my work properly, or fail to control my budget and splurge on shopping ... one of these days ... trouble will be coming my way.
